+From b71cd09cefcd54e792a2ac032c3be64a97ef830c Mon Sep 17 00:00:00 2001
+From: Vikram Pandita <vikram.pandita@ti.com>
+Date: Fri, 12 Jun 2009 17:44:07 -0500
+Subject: [PATCH 2/8] OMAP3:Zoom2: Add TWL4030 support
+
+Add TWL4030 CORE and TWL4030 drivers to Zoom2 board file
+TWL drivers enabled are:
+ bci
+ madc
+ usb
+ keypad
+ mmc
+
+Signed-off-by: Vikram Pandita <vikram.pandita@ti.com>
